China's COFCO to supply non-modified corn to Japan
COFCO Limited, a leading grain, oils and foodstuffs import and export group in China, has signed a contract with a Japanese company to supply top-quality non-modified corn to Japan from now on.
Gu Lifeng, vice general manager at COFCO, said he was glad that Japanese consumers have accepted China-produced non-modified corn.
On the other hand, COFCO recently tied up a deal with the Xinxiang Government of Henan Province on the establishment of a grain storage and logistics centre.
The project is initiated in order to better the services of source control, efficient transit and value-added trade. With implementations on a higher level basis and based on stricter standards, the centre will be focusing on transit service and it will be operated on a decentralised basis.
